Product details

This small crab apple provides profuse white tinged pink in bud flowers in the spring and a good yellow autumn colour. Yellow / green and occasionally red flushed fruits are a favourite for birds in the autumn.

Most suited to heavy and clay soils this small tree is rarely seen above twenty feet in height and is the parent of numerous crab and eating apple varieties.

Ideal for native mixed planting or shelterbelts that provide great low cover for wildlife.

If you live in an area prone to rabbits or deer then we recommend rabbit guards for these trees.

Mature height: 3-7m

Mature spread: 3-6m
